Keiretsu Forum is the largest North American angel network with 500 accredited investor members. Since September 2000, Keiretsu Forum members have invested over $140M in 150 companies in technology, healthcare/life sciences, consumer products, real estate and other segments with high growth potential. Our community is strengthened through education on angel investing, as well as charitable and social activities.
